Foreign Ministry Returns to Iraqi Governance
Iraq Fact of the Day

Full authority of the Ministry of Foreign Affairs was formally handed back to the Iraqi people recently. Since his appointment last year, Minister Hoshyar Zebari and his staff have re-opened nearly 50 embassies worldwide. The Ministry is undertaking internal reform based on equal rights, democracy and good governance. Selections for diplomats are merit based, and young men and women are being trained to represent the integrity and ideals of the new Iraq. This is the 10th ministry to assume direct authority and is a significant step toward a sovereign Iraqi government.
